testing upstream kernel
using: linux-image-3.2.0-18-generic
from here: http://kernel.ubuntu.com/~kernel-ppa/mainline/v3.3-rc6-precise/
boots into gui. Have my desktop etc.
from terminal window: sudo pm-suspend
screen freezes with last image, hard disk stops, cpu and psu
fans stay on, unresponsive
hard restart, opens clean desktop, lost settings
sudo pm-hibernate
screen flashes, freezes with following text:
[ 62.773430] [drm] nouveau 0000:00:0d.0: =======0x0060081D=======
[ 62.773430] [drm] nouveau 0000:00:0d.0: =======0x0060081D=======
, hard disk stops, cpu and psu fans stay on, unresponsive
hard restart, opens all windows from last time.
Also
Took out 2 gig of RAM, rebooted into 2.6.32-38, problem persists. Did this
because I read someone else solved a similar issue due to not enough swap, they
needed over 2x ram. I have 5.5gig swap, 2 or 4 gig RAM makes no difference.
